8 Steps to Replace an Oil Pump
Replacing an oil pump involves careful planning and attention to detail. You need to gather the appropriate tools, follow precise steps to access the component, and ensure proper alignment during installation.
Gather Materials and Tools
Start by collecting all necessary tools and materials. These include a socket set, wrenches (especially a 10mm spanner), an oil catch pan, and new gaskets. You'll need replacement parts like the oil pump itself, seals, and gaskets. Having sealant ready is essential for reassembly. Double-check that you have a torque wrench for tightening bolts to the manufacturer's specifications, along with a puller for removing difficult components like the crank pulley. Ensure you've ordered the correct oil pump model.
Identify the Oil Pump Location
Understanding the engine layout is vital. Typically, the oil pump is located inside the timing cover, near the crankshaft. In some vehicles, accessing it may require removing the valve cover and parts of the timing system like the timing belt. Consult your vehicle's service manual for specifics on the positioning. This ensures you're fully aware of what components may need to be temporarily removed to gain access to the pump.
Drain Engine Oil
Before you begin disassembly, drain the engine oil completely to prevent leaks. Place an oil catch pan beneath the oil pan's drain plug, and allow all the oil to flow out. This step is crucial to prevent spillage when removing the oil pan. Proper disposal of used oil is vital—take it to a recycling centre or garage that handles oil waste.
Remove the Oil Pan
To access the oil pump, removal of the oil pan is required. Unbolt all the retaining bolts with a socket set. Gently tap the oil pan with a rubber mallet to break the seal. Be cautious not to damage any surfaces. Once removed, clean the pan's contact surface on both the pan and the engine block to ensure a proper seal upon reassembly.
Access the Oil Pump
Now that the oil pan is off, locate the oil pump. You may need to remove additional components like the oil pick-up tube. In some cases, the crankshaft or crank pulley might partially obstruct access, necessitating further disassembly. Using a puller can help remove obstructions like the crank pulley bolt if necessary. Ensuring all parts are meticulously tracked and organised is essential for smooth reassembly later.
Disconnect Oil Pump Components
Start disconnecting components connected to the oil pump. This usually involves unbolting the oil pump's mounting bolts and detaching linkages or oil pump shaft if present. Take note of any washers, o-rings, or small parts that may fall away as you work. If needed, use a woodruff key to secure or release the pump. Proper handling ensures all parts remain undamaged during the removal.
Install the New Oil Pump
With the old oil pump removed, prepare the new pump for installation. Check that the new pump matches all specifications for your vehicle. Position it in place, ensuring it's properly aligned with the crankshaft. Attach any necessary components, and confirm all seals and gaskets are correctly placed. Using sealant, secure the oil pump and torque the bolts to the specified settings in the manual to prevent leaks.
Reassemble Components
Begin reassembly by attaching any previously removed components in the reverse order. Ensure that gaskets and seals are correctly aligned and seated. Pay particular attention to the timing cover and related parts such as the timing belt and water pump. Refill the engine with fresh oil once reassembled. Double-check all bolts for proper torque and make sure no pieces are left loose. This guarantees a leak-free and efficient oil pump operation after you've restarted the engine.

What Are the Common Signs of a Failing Oil Pump?
A failing oil pump can manifest through a few key symptoms. One of the primary indicators is low oil pressure. If you notice the oil pressure gauge indicating below normal levels, it could suggest an issue with the oil pump's performance.
The oil light on your dashboard may also illuminate. This warning light usually signals low oil pressure, which can coincide with a malfunctioning oil pump. It's crucial to address this promptly to avoid engine damage.
Increased engine temperature is another sign. A failing oil pump may struggle to circulate the oil efficiently, leading to inadequate lubrication and cooling of engine components. If the temperature gauge shows higher than normal, it might be due to poor oil circulation.
Unusual noises are often associated with oil pump issues. You might hear a hydraulic lifter noise or valve-train noise, which could result from insufficient oil reaching these vital parts. These noises indicate that the oil is not providing the necessary cushioning.
In some cases, the oil pump itself may produce a distinct noise. If you detect an abnormal mechanical sound coming from the engine, especially near the crank position, it could stem from the oil pump experiencing difficulty in maintaining proper oil flow.
Engines with thicker oil might exacerbate these issues due to the pump's inability to handle the increased viscosity. Always ensure your oil matches the manufacturer’s recommendations to prevent or minimise these problems.

What Should I Do If I Encounter Oil Leaks After Replacing the Oil Pump?
If you notice oil leaks after replacing the oil pump, several steps can help identify and resolve the issue.
First, inspect the gasket between the oil pump and the engine block. Ensure it was installed correctly, as an improper seal is a common cause of leaks.
Check the oil pan gasket and the sump feed line. Ensure these are tight and properly sealed. A loose or damaged seal here can also lead to leaks.
Verify the tightness of all bolts. The oil pump should be properly secured to avoid any misalignment that could cause leaking. Use a torque wrench to ensure each bolt is set to the manufacturer's specifications.
Examine the front seal and timing chain cover for damage or wear. Replacement may be necessary if they show signs of degradation.
Consider the PCV308 modification, especially in high-pressure scenarios. This modification can help address leaks caused by pressure issues in some vehicles, as suggested within the car enthusiast communities.
If these steps don't rectify the issue, re-evaluate the entire installation for any potential errors. Consulting a professional mechanic might be prudent if leaks persist despite thorough checks and adjustments.

Should I Replace the Oil Pan Gasket Every Time I Replace the Oil Pump?
When you replace an oil pump, it often involves removing the oil pan. Since the oil pan gasket is a crucial seal, assess its condition during this process.
Consider replacing the oil pan gasket if:
- The gasket shows signs of wear: Look for cracks, tears, or brittleness.
- Leaks are present: Oil leaks around the gasket area signal a seal failure.
If the gasket is in good condition:
- Retaining the same gasket is possible: This applies if it appears intact and isn't showing signs of deterioration.
- Replace it only if necessary: While not mandatory every time, replacing the gasket may prevent future leaks.
Advantages of replacing the oil pan gasket:
- Prevents future complications: A new gasket can help avoid oil leaks, which could lead to engine damage.
- Saves labour costs and time later on: It might be economical to do both replacements simultaneously.
Using gasket maker or sealant might extend the life of the existing gasket, but this requires careful application to ensure a proper seal. Consider the state of the gasket and any advice from your vehicle manual before deciding on replacement to ensure your vehicle's reliability.
